     | Conference Agenda
 The White House Conference on Philanthropy took place on October 22, 1999 in the East Wing of the White House. The following agenda reflects the two hour satellite broadcast. 
      |    
    | 1:00pm- 3:00pm EST | Expanding the American Tradition of Giving This first session explored ways that the American tradition of philanthropy can be expanded and passed on to future generation as we enter a new century and new millennium.
 
  Discussants:
    
    Emmett D. Carson, President and CEO, The Minneapolis Foundation
    Peter D. Hart, Peter D. Hart Research Associates
    Dorothy A. Johnson, President, Council on Michigan Foundations
    Justin R. Timberlake, N'SYNC
   
  New Giving for the New MillenniumAmerican philanthropy, like America itself, is changing.  Many new, creative forms of giving will characterize the new century.  New donors, particularly those from technology, have become innovators in philanthropy and have found kindred spirits among social entrepreneurs who are applying new thinking and business solutions to community problems.
  Discussants:
 
    Kevin A. Fong, General Partner, Mayfield Fund
      Catherine Muther, Founder, Three Guineas Fund
      Steve Case, Chairman and CEO, America Online
      William P. Massey, President, National Charities Information Bureau
